Driver Arrested after Suspected DUI Crash on West Turquoise Road

LAS VEGAS, NV (June 7, 2022) – Saturday evening, Morgan Rene Arvizo died in a hit-and-run crash on North Rancho Drive, police said.

On June 4th, Vegas Officials stated the crash occurred on North Rancho Drive and West Turquoise Road.

Per initial reports, Arvizo was riding a motorcycle traveling southbound when a pickup truck heading northbound struck him for reasons unknown.

The victim was pronounced dead at the scene, and the truck driver attempted to flee but was quickly apprehended by authorities.

Additionally, the driver was taken to Clark County Detention Center with DUI and hit-and-run charges. Furthermore, both directions of the roadway were temporarily closed to allow for cleanup and preliminary duties.

An active investigation into the crash is underway.
